The general cost of acquiring a driving license in Poland can differ significantly based on the type of license being pursued, the driving school picked, and Prawo Jazdy Kat B Cena additional testing needed. Here's a breakdown of the common expenses related to acquiring a driving license in Poland:
1. Driving School Fees
The first and typically most considerable expense relates to registering in a driving school. The cost can vary based upon the package you select and the area you remain in. Below is a basic pricing guide:
ServiceApproximated Cost (PLN)Basic Driving Course (Category B)2,000 - 3,000Extended Package (including extra lessons)3,000 - 4,500Bike Course (Category A)2,500 - 3,500Truck Course (Category C)4,000 - 6,000Bus Course (Category D)5,000 - 7,000Additional Costs:Extra Lessons: 100 - 200 PLN per hourDriving Simulation Classes: 150 - 300 PLN per session2. Assessment Fees
After finishing the necessary training, prospects must pass two evaluations: a theoretical test and a useful driving test. The charges related to these tests are:
Test TypeEstimated Cost (PLN)Theoretical Exam30 - 50Practical Driving Exam140 - 2003. Medical Examination
Before requesting a driving license, prospects must go through a medical evaluation to ensure they fulfill the health requirements essential to drive. This cost typically varies from:
Medical ExaminationApproximated Cost (PLN)Medical Examination Fee100 - 2004. Document Fees
When you have actually effectively passed your tests and finished your training, there are extra charges to think about for the licensing process itself:
Document TypeEstimated Cost (PLN)Application for License50 - 100Issuance of the Driving License100 - 200Overall Estimated Costs
In summary, a rough quote of the overall costs involved in acquiring a driving license in Poland can be detailed in the table below:
Expense CategoryEstimated Range (PLN)Driving School Fees2,000 - 7,000Examination Fees170 - 250Medical exam100 - 200File Fees150 - 300Overall Estimated Cost2,420 - 7,750Additional Considerations

Can I take the driving test in English?
Yes, some areas in Poland provide driving tests in English, but it's a good idea to talk to your local driving school or the licensing workplace to verify accessibility.
2. For how long is the driving license valid in Poland?
A standard driving license is legitimate for 15 years. Upon expiration, you will require to renew it, which involves a medical evaluation and payment of charges.
3. Are there any discounts offered for driving schools?
Lots of driving schools might use discounts or payment plans, especially for trainees or groups. It's worth inquiring directly with the school.
4. Do I require to take a medical examination if I have a driving license from another country?
If you have a valid driving license from another EU country, you typically do not require a medical examination. Nevertheless, it is crucial to verify the specific requirements with Polish authorities.
